    The Riccati equation method is used to establish stability criteria for systems of two first-order linear ordinary differential equations. (Other articles involving Riccati method includes but not limited to: [\textit{G. A. Grigorian}, Math. Pannonica 26, No. 1, 67--101 (2017; Zbl 1424.34060); Differ. Equ. 47, No. 9, 1237--1252 (2011; Zbl 1244.34051); translation from Differ. Uravn. 47, No. 9, 1225--1240 (2011); ``On some properties of solutions of the Riccati equation'', Izvestiya NAS of Armenia 42, No. 4, 11--26 (2007)].) Examples are presented in which the obtained result is compared with the results obtained by the Lyapunov and Bogdanov methods, by a method involving estimates of solutions in the Lozinskii logarithmic norms and by the freezing method.
